White Mountain Country Club is an 18-hole golf course in Pinetop, AZ with a par of 72. It offers 7 tee sets: black (6,523 yards, slope 120, rating 69.4), black/blue (6,470 yards, slope 119, rating 69.2), blue (6,333 yards, slope 116, rating 68.4), blue/white (6,000 yards, slope 111, rating 67), white (5,717 yards, slope 108, rating 65.5), white/green (5,298 yards, slope 103, rating 63.8), green (4,969 yards, slope 97, rating 62.2). The hardest hole is #5, a par 5 playing 600 yards from the first tee.

Scorecard
| Hole |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 6 | 7 | 8 | 9 | Out | 10 | 11 | 12 | 13 | 14 | 15 | 16 | 17 | 18 | In | Tot |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Par | 4 | 4 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 4 | 5 | 5 | 3 | 37 | 4 | 5 | 3 | 4 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 3 | 4 | 35 | 72 |
| HCP | 9 | 11 | 17 | 5 | 1 | 13 | 3 | 7 | 15 | 12 | 2 | 14 | 10 | 16 | 8 | 4 | 18 | 6 | |||
| black | 361 | 349 | 240 | 414 | 613 | 334 | 503 | 527 | 153 | 3494 | 315 | 543 | 178 | 330 | 208 | 302 | 493 | 220 | 440 | 3029 | 6523 |
| black/blue | 361 | 349 | 226 | 406 | 600 | 334 | 503 | 527 | 153 | 3459 | 315 | 543 | 178 | 330 | 208 | 302 | 493 | 210 | 432 | 3011 | 6470 |
| blue | 350 | 339 | 226 | 406 | 600 | 320 | 496 | 520 | 146 | 3403 | 302 | 527 | 167 | 325 | 198 | 293 | 476 | 210 | 432 | 2930 | 6333 |
| blue/white | 344 | 339 | 179 | 348 | 521 | 320 | 496 | 520 | 146 | 3213 | 302 | 498 | 167 | 325 | 187 | 293 | 463 | 188 | 364 | 2787 | 6000 |
| white | 344 | 327 | 179 | 348 | 521 | 300 | 433 | 417 | 115 | 2984 | 293 | 498 | 151 | 306 | 187 | 283 | 463 | 188 | 364 | 2733 | 5717 |
| white/green | 266 | 327 | 135 | 348 | 429 | 300 | 433 | 403 | 115 | 2756 | 293 | 448 | 151 | 306 | 138 | 283 | 438 | 163 | 322 | 2542 | 5298 |
| green | 266 | 302 | 135 | 299 | 429 | 229 | 392 | 403 | 111 | 2566 | 281 | 448 | 135 | 254 | 138 | 224 | 438 | 163 | 322 | 2403 | 4969 |
